One thousand five hundred sixteen
1,516 is written "one thousand five hundred sixteen". British English inserts "and" before the final part, giving "one thousand five hundred and sixteen"; American English leaves it out.

Writing it on a cheque
On a cheque the amount line reads "One thousand five hundred and sixteen and 00/100" — or "One thousand five hundred and sixteen only" in Indian and much of Commonwealth practice. The fraction or the word "only" exists to stop anyone appending digits after what you wrote. Draw a line through any space left over for the same reason.
